I don't know if it's the same thing with you, but in Wallonia, we have leek plague.
A small creature that enters between the leaves of the leek to leave purple traces in the white and a small brownish envelope.
It's not ringworm, it's new. It seems that it resists NEXTION, a virulent pesticide. I do not use these crap.
What is certain is that everyone complains.
What are we going to eat if we can no longer eat our "Gros de Liège".
Finally if you have an info above I am interested.
